Your Guide to Finding JBR Hotel Apartments for Rent

Jumeirah Beach Residence stretches along 1.7 kilometres of Gulf coastline and sits directly beside Dubai Marina, making it one of the most recognisable beachfront addresses in the city. The community is built around The Walk and The Beach, two pedestrian strips lined with retail, dining, and entertainment, giving residents everything they need within a short stroll. A JBR hotel apartment for rent combines the convenience of serviced living with a location that is hard to match in Dubai.

The area draws a broad mix of residents. Professionals value the tram connections to Dubai Media City and the Marina. Families are drawn to the open beaches, safe walkways, and nearby schools. The trade-off is that JBR is a busy, high-footfall neighbourhood, particularly on weekends and during the cooler months, so residents who prefer quiet surroundings should factor that into the decision.

Market Overview

JBR hotel apartment rentals sit at a premium compared to standard residential towers in nearby communities, reflecting the beachfront location and the all-inclusive nature of most serviced contracts. Utility bills, internet, air conditioning, and regular housekeeping are typically bundled into the annual rate, which simplifies budgeting considerably.

Studios in the community average around AED 140,500 per year, while three-bedroom units in premium towers can reach AED 550,000 annually. Unit sizes range from around 592 sq ft for a compact studio to over 2,200 sq ft for a large three-bedroom layout. Most JBR hotel apartments are fully furnished with modern interiors, resort-style pools, and direct or close beach access, which accounts for much of the price premium over comparable inland apartments in Dubai.

Demand for hotel apartments for rent in Dubai of this type remains strong year-round, with particular interest from corporate tenants, short-term residents, and professionals on relocation packages who want a ready-to-move-in home without setup costs.

Why Choose Hotel Apartments in JBR for Rent?

Beachfront living with daily convenience

JBR sits directly on the Gulf with public and private beaches accessible on foot. The Walk and The Beach bring cafes, restaurants, cinemas, and retail right outside the building's entrance.

All-inclusive pricing

Most JBR hotel apartment contracts bundle utilities, internet, and housekeeping into the rent. This removes the need to set up DEWA accounts or manage separate service bills, which is a practical advantage for new arrivals.

Strong transport links

Two Dubai Tram stations serve the community, connecting residents to the DMCC and Sobha Realty Metro stations. For those who do not own a car, JBR is one of the more transit-accessible beachfront addresses in Dubai.

Top Towers for JBR Hotel Apartments for Rent 

The Address Jumeirah Resort and Spa (Jumeirah Gate Tower 2): With annual rents ranging from AED 170,000 for one-bedroom units to AED 550,000 for three-bedroom layouts and sizes between 784 and 2,200 sq ft, this tower offers a premium residential experience. Residents enjoy panoramic views of Bluewaters Island along with access to a rooftop infinity pool, in-house dining, spa facilities, and a standout concierge service. The development is particularly well-suited to executives and residents seeking an uncompromised resort-style lifestyle as a permanent address.

Sheraton The Walk: With studios starting from AED 140,500 per year and three-bedroom units averaging AED 366,500 annually, this development offers a range of spacious residences, making it a strong alternative to traditional houses for rent in Dubai. The building features landscaped gardens, a private beach area, and immediate access to The Walk’s retail strip. As a long-established option within the community, it offers a more relaxed atmosphere compared to newer towers, making it well-suited to families and professionals who prioritise location and daily convenience over cutting-edge interiors.

Hilton Dubai The Walk: With two-bedroom units starting from AED 275,000 per year and four-bedroom penthouses reaching up to AED 949,999 annually, this development offers a range of stylish residences. The interiors are complemented by shared private beach access, multiple on-site restaurants, and direct connectivity to the adjacent Hilton Jumeirah Resort, providing additional dining and leisure options. The property is particularly well-suited to residents who value culinary variety and prefer to enjoy evening entertainment within the complex itself.

Roda Amwaj Suites: With two-bedroom apartments starting from AED 215,000 per year and three-bedroom units at AED 280,000 per year and sizes ranging from 1,168 to 1,582 sq ft, these residences are located in the Amwaj cluster. The development offers a wellness centre, swimming pools, conference rooms, and a Kcal restaurant on the ground floor. It is considered one of the more competitively priced hotel apartments for monthly rent in Dubai at this quality level. The property is particularly well-suited to remote workers, fitness-focused residents, and those seeking strong value within the JBR hotel apartment market.

Location and Transportation

JBR borders Dubai Marina to the east and faces Bluewaters Island across the water. King Salman Bin Abdulaziz Al Saud Street and Sheikh Zayed Road are the primary road connections, keeping most of the city within easy reach by car. A pedestrian bridge links the mainland directly to Bluewaters Island.

The Dubai Tram stops at Jumeirah Beach Residence 1 and 2 stations, connecting residents to the DMCC and Sobha Realty Metro stations on the Red Line. Bus stops at Marsa Dubai JBR 1 and 2 provide additional local routes. Taxis and ride-hailing apps are available at all hours throughout the community.

Commute times from JBR are reasonable for a beachfront location. Dubai Marina is around five minutes by car, Dubai Media City is approximately 15 minutes, and Dubai International Airport is about 30 minutes under normal traffic conditions.

FAQs about JBR Hotel Apartments for Rent

Are utility bills included in hotel apartments in JBR for rent? 

Yes, the majority of serviced listings in JBR, including many affordable hotel apartments for rent in Dubai, bundle electricity, water, air conditioning, and internet into the annual rental rate. However, it is still important to confirm the exact inclusions with the building or management before signing the lease.

Do JBR hotel apartment residents get beach access? 

Most premium towers, including The Address Jumeirah Resort and Spa, Sheraton The Walk, and Hilton Dubai The Walk, offer private beach areas for residents. The public JBR beach is also freely accessible to all.

Is JBR a practical location for daily commuting? 

Yes, the two tram stations connect to the Dubai Metro Red Line, making commutes to Dubai Marina, JLT, Media City, and beyond manageable without a car.

Are furnished studios for monthly rent available in JBR? 

Yes, buildings like Roda Amwaj Suites offer furnished studios and apartments on flexible terms, making them accessible for short-stay residents and those looking for hotel apartments for monthly rent in Dubai at a more accessible price point.

Is JBR suitable for families with children? 

The community has safe pedestrian zones, nurseries within walking distance, outdoor play areas, and family attractions, including AquaFun Waterpark. It is a practical and engaging environment for families, though the busy atmosphere is worth considering for those with very young children.

What is the parking situation for hotel apartment residents in JBR? 

Residents are typically allocated dedicated covered parking within their building. Guest and visitor parking is limited and can be costly, given the volume of visitors the area receives, particularly on weekends.
